在suse10 中使用rc.local
时间:2009-06-04 来源:binary_XY.Z
suse10中没有rc.local, 感觉用起来不是很方便
suse linux 沒有這個檔案,另外策略就是也不喜歡使用者這樣管理啟動服務。
若你有某各服務服務需要是在進入 runlevel 後才執行的話,於 suse 下正規做法應該是自己寫一個 rc script 檔案放置於 /etc/init.d/ 目錄內,然後使用 chkconfig or inssev 程式來管理配置能夠於某個 runlevel 環境開機時是否要啟用關閉該服務項目。
該 rc script 檔案寫法可以自己參考一下 /etc/init.d/ 裡面現成的 script 檔案,應該很容易就寫一個自己的版本。
另外 suse 有個 /etc/init.d/boot.local 檔案是由 /etc/init.d/boot 這個 script 所啟動的,而且是最後 boot script 工作完成要準備進入 runlevel 環境執行各項 rc script 前所執行。而 rh 的 /etc/rc.d/rc.local 檔案是 runlevel 環境執行各項 rc script 時最後一個階段執行的。
所以若你要跑的程式適合於 runlevel 這項服務之前就執行的話,suse linux 可以放於 boot.local 檔案。
摘自: http://linux.chinaunix.net/bbs/viewthread.php?tid=715974
相关阅读 更多 +